Homebrew 快速上手教程


【教程来自ChatGPT】

使用 Homebrew 安装软件的流程通常包括以下几个步骤:更新 Homebrew、搜索软件、安装软件、检查安装和配置。以下是详细的教程:

1. 安装 Homebrew

首先,确保 Homebrew 已安装。如果未安装,可以通过以下命令安装:

  1. /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

安装过程中,系统会要求你输入管理员密码。

2. 更新 Homebrew

在安装任何软件之前,建议更新 Homebrew 到最新版本:

  1. brew update

这个命令会确保 Homebrew 的软件库是最新的,避免你遇到安装软件时的潜在问题。

3. 搜索软件

Homebrew 提供了强大的搜索功能,帮助你查找可安装的软件包。使用以下命令搜索你需要的软件:

  1. brew search <软件名称>

例如,搜索 Node.js:

  1. brew search node

如果 Homebrew 中有该软件包,返回的列表将显示相关软件名称和版本。

4. 安装软件

找到你需要的软件包后,可以使用 brew install 命令安装。以安装 Node.js 为例:

  1. brew install node

这个命令会自动下载并安装软件及其依赖项。你只需等待安装过程完成。

5. 验证安装

安装完成后,可以验证软件是否已成功安装。例如,安装 Node.js 后,可以运行以下命令检查版本:

  1. node -v

如果返回了版本号,则表明安装成功。

6. 配置软件(如需要)

某些软件在安装后可能需要额外的配置步骤。可以查看安装过程中 Homebrew 提供的提示,或者查阅相关文档。例如,安装某些命令行工具后,可能需要将其路径添加到 ~/.zshrc~/.bash_profile 文件中。

例如,安装完 NVM 后,需要将以下内容添加到 ~/.zshrc~/.bash_profile 文件中:

  1. export NVM_DIR="$HOME/.nvm"
  2. [ -s "/opt/homebrew/opt/nvm/nvm.sh" ] && \. "/opt/homebrew/opt/nvm/nvm.sh" # This loads nvm

保存并执行:

  1. source ~/.zshrc # 或 source ~/.bash_profile

7. 升级软件

如果你需要升级已安装的软件,使用以下命令:

  1. brew upgrade <软件名称>

如果想要升级所有已安装的软件,可以直接运行:

  1. brew upgrade

8. 删除软件

如果某个软件不再需要,使用以下命令卸载:

  1. brew uninstall <软件名称>

例如,卸载 Node.js:

  1. brew uninstall node

9. 清理不再需要的文件

安装和卸载软件时,Homebrew 可能会留下不再需要的旧版本软件和缓存文件。使用以下命令清理这些文件:

  1. brew cleanup

总结

  1. 安装 Homebrew/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
  2. 更新 Homebrewbrew update
  3. 搜索软件brew search <软件名称>
  4. 安装软件brew install <软件名称>
  5. 验证安装<软件名称> -v
  6. 配置软件(如果需要)
  7. 升级软件brew upgrade <软件名称>brew upgrade
  8. 卸载软件brew uninstall <软件名称>
  9. 清理缓存和旧版本brew cleanup

按照这个流程,你就可以快速地使用 Homebrew 安装、管理和配置各种软件了。